What causes drywall damage?
Drywall damage can occur due to various reasons, including leaking water, impact, structural settling, poor installation, or gradual deterioration.
How can I tell that my drywall is in need of fixing?
Look for signs such as cracking, holes, staining from water, or swelling patches on your drywall. If you notice these issues, it's time to consider drywall repair.
Is it recommended to tackle drywall issues myself, or should I seek the help of a professional?
It depends on the extent of the damage and your DIY skills. Small holes and minor cracks can often be repaired by homeowners. However, for extensive damage or uncertainty, hiring a professional like us is recommended.
How fix larger holes in the wall?
For larger holes, you may need to patch the area with a drywall patch or reinforcement tape, apply joint compound, sand, and then apply a new coat of paint.

What tools and materials are necessary for a do-it-yourself drywall repair?
Basic tools include a putty knife, joint compound, sandpaper, drywall saw, reinforcement tape, and paint. Depending on the repair type, you might need additional items.
How long does it usually take?
The time for drywall repair varies based on the extent of the damage. Minor repairs can often be finished in a few hours, while extensive repairs might require a day or longer.
Can water-damaged drywall be fixed, or does it need to be replaced?
Minor water damage can often be repaired, but extensive damage might necessitate replacing of the affected drywall.
